Paleo Chocolate Chip Cookies with Walnuts

Yields1 Serving

These Paleo cookies are made with Walnuts and Chocolate Chips for a tasty crunch. They can be made vegan by substituting the egg for an egg replacer.

 2 cups almond flour
 1/2 teaspoon baking soda
 1/2 teaspoon celtic sea salt
 1/4 cup grass fed butter or coconut butter
 1/2 cup coconut blossom nectar
 1 large egg (or egg replacer if vegan)
 1 tablespoon vanilla extract
 1/2 cup dark chocolate chips (gluten, sugar, dairy, soy free)
 1/2 cup walnut halves

1. Preheat the oven to 350f/175c.

2. Sift the almond flour, baking soda and the salt into a medium sized bowl.

3. In a standing mixer, butter and the coconut blossom nectar together. Add the vanilla extract and the egg, continuing to mix. Stop to scrape down the sides if necessary.

4. Stir in chocolate chips and walnuts if desired.

5. Scoop out balls of cookie dough using a large spoon or a small cookie scoop. Each cookie should be approximately 2 tablespoons, rolled into balls.

6. Place on a baking sheet lined with parchment paper and flatten the dough into the desired thickness, as it does not spread when cooking.

7. Cook for 10-12 minutes. Cool before serving.
